NAME¶
idn2_strerror_name - API function
SYNOPSIS¶
#include <idn2.h>
const char * idn2_strerror_name(int rc);
ARGUMENTS¶
- int rc
- return code from another libidn2 function.
DESCRIPTION¶
Convert internal libidn2 error code to a string corresponding to internal header
file symbols. For example, idn2_strerror_name(IDN2_MALLOC) will return the
string "IDN2_MALLOC".
The caller must not attempt to de-allocate the returned string.
RETURN VALUE¶
A string corresponding to error code symbol.
